اتصالات در مکانیک به دو دسته دائم و جداشدنی تقسیم می شوند. بدون شک، جوش بعنوان یکی از اتصالات دائمی همواره مورد توجه محققین و صنعتگران بوده است به نحوی که بسیاری از خبرگان این حوزه، جوش را گلوگاه صنعت می نامند. تحلیل انتقال حرارت در پروسه جوشکاری نیز از موضوعات مورد علاقه پژوهشگران برای مدلسازی در نرمافزار آباکوس است. با توجه به اهمیت موضوع تصمیم گرفتیم تا آموزش مدلسازی فرآیند جوشکاری و آنالیز انتقال حرارت آن در آباکوس را برای شما عزیزان آماده کنیم. با ما در این آموزش همراه باشید.
تذکر: در تاریخ 4 خرداد 95 آوزشی تحت عنوان “مدلسازی و تحلیل جوش T شکل در آباکوس” در سایت قرار گرفت. در صورت علاقه به مبحث جوشکاری به هیچ عنوان آن آموزش کاربردی را از دست ندهید.
صورت مسئله مدلسازی و تحلیل انتقال حرارت در فرآیند جوشکاری توسط آباکوس
هدف از این آموزش پروژه محور، شبیهسازی انتقال حرارتی است که در منطقه خط جوش ایجاد می شود. قطعه مورد نظر برای این تحلیل؛ یک ورق مطابق شکل زیر است.
◄ حوزه کاربرد: مهندسی مکانیک – مهندسی مواد (متالورژی) – مهندسی صنایع – مهندسی عمران
حل مسئله شبیهسازی و آنالیز انتقال حرارت در فرآیند جوشکاری توسط نرمافزار Abaqus
با توجه به ماهیت سهبعدی مسئله، از ماژول Part و با انتخاب حالت 3D، Deformable به ایجاد یک مکعب با ابعاد مشخص شده در شکل فوق بپردازید. حتما متوجه شدهاید که مکعب زیر بیانگر دو قطعه پس از فرآیند جوشکاری است.
در ادامه و در محیط Property مطابق جدول زیر، خواص مکانیکی و حرارتی مورد نظر را وارد نمایید. بحث انتقال حرارت هدایت در طول پروسه جوشکاری، ضرورت تعریف ضریب Conductivity را در این ماژول نشان می دهد.
Density | Specific Heat | Conductivity | Yield Stress | Poisson’s Ratio | Young’s Modulus |
7.8 g/cm^3 | 1 | 43 | 164 MPa | 0.3 | 200 GPa |
سپس مقطعی از نوع Solid را برای تحلیل انتخاب کرده و پس از تعریف، به مکعب مورد نظر اختصاص دهید.
پس از طی مراحل فوق، وارد ماژول Assembly شده و مکعب مورد نظر را در اصطلاح مونتاژ کنید. از آنجایی که برای تحلیل انتقال حرارت در نرم افزار Abaqus، به المان نیاز داریم، بر خلاف روند متداول تحلیل مسئله به ماژول Mesh رفته و شبکه ای با اندازه المان 5 را برای مکعب مورد نظر بکار می گیریم.
وجود المانهای گوناگون در بخش کتابخانه جهت تحلیل اجزای محدود مسائل گوناگون، از برجستهترین نقاط قوت آباکوس به شمار می رود (خانواده المانها در آباکوس). بحث انتقال حرارت نیز از متداولترین مباحث صنعتی به شمار می رود. از اینرو المانهای ویژه ای برای این موضوع در نرم افزار Abaqus تعبیه شده است. در بخش Element Type ، از المانهای Standard خطی ویژه تحلیل انتقال حرارت کمک می گیریم.
حال به ماژول Assembly بازگشته و با استفاده از مسیر Tools → Set → Create در منوی اصلی، نسبت به انتخاب دسته المانهای مربوط به خط جوش اقدام می کنیم. با توجه به ماهیت مسئله، باید هشت المان موجود در راستای طولی ورق را در هشت Set جداگانه قرار دهیم (مطابق مسیر فوق).
در ادامه به محیط Step رفته و مطابق شکل زیر یک حل حرارتی را انتخاب می کنیم.
سپس، به زبانه Incrementation وارد شده و حداکثر تغییرات دمایی در هر Increment را معادل 50 واحد لحاظ می کنیم.
همانگونه که در گام قبل نیز اشاره شد، باید هشت Step جداگانه مانند بالا ایجاد کنیم. فراموش نکنید به کمک بخش Edit History Output Request در همین ماژول، خروجیهای ضروری در تحلیل انتقال حرارت را فعال نمایید.
در مراحل پیشین تحلیل، به ایجاد هشت Set از المانهای خط جوش اشاره کردیم. حال در ماژول Load به تعریف بار حرارتی برای این مجموعه خواهیم پرداخت. برای اینکه بار حرارتی ایجاد شده در هر Step بر روی سایر گامهای حل تأثیرگذار نباشد (فرآیند جوشکاری را بخاطر بیاورید. الکترود رو به جلو حرکت کرده و در هر لحظه بار حرارتی تنها به یک ناحیه وارد می شود)، وارد Load manager شده و بارگذاری را در مراحل بعد به حالت غیر فعال در آورید.
از آنجایی که فرآیند ایجاد شبکه اجزای محدود را پیشتر انجام دادهایم، نیازی به طی این مرحله در ماژول Mesh نبوده و همه چیز برای انجام یک تحلیل انتقال حرارت از فرآیند جوشکاری در نرم افزار آباکوس آماده است. شکل متحرک زیر نیز نشان دهنده کانتور دمایی در امتداد خط جوش در این تحلیل است.
منبع : آکادمی نرمافزارهای مکانیک
قطعه از ابتدا پارتیشن بندی نشده است البته اگر درست متوجه شده باشم. بنابراین چگونه باید بارگذاری را برای هر استپ انجام داد؟
با تشکر از توجه شما
اگر با دقت مطالعه میکردید متوجه میشدید:
“از آنجایی که برای تحلیل انتقال حرارت در نرم افزار Abaqus، به المان نیاز داریم، بر خلاف روند متداول تحلیل مسئله به ماژول Mesh رفته و شبکه ای با اندازه المان 5 را برای مکعب مورد نظر بکار می گیریم.”
در ادامه هم عرض کردم:
“حال به ماژول Assembly بازگشته و با استفاده از مسیر Tools → Set → Create در منوی اصلی، نسبت به انتخاب دسته المانهای مربوط به خط جوش اقدام می کنیم. با توجه به ماهیت مسئله، باید هشت المان موجود در راستای طولی ورق را در هشت Set جداگانه قرار دهیم”
ما از المانها set ایجاد کردیم و بارگذاری را به set ها اعمال کردیم؛ نیازی به پارتیشن نیست
موفق باشید . . .
سلام، خسته نباشید و ممنون از سایت بسیار آموزنده تان
ببخشید یه سوال داشتم
میزان دانسیته را برای قطعه بالا چه مقدار در نظر گرفته اید؟
سلام
ممنون از توجه شما
چگالی: 7.8g/cm^3
با سلام و تشکر از این مثال آموزنده تحلیل انتقال حرارت در فرآیند جوشکاری.
دوست عزیز من این مدل را در آباکوس مطابق راهنمایی های شما در این سایت انجام دادم. پس از ارسال به job و شروع تحلیل 8 عد Warning با عنوان زیر مشاهده شد و تحلیل قطع شد. لطفا راهنمایی بفرمایید. با تشکر
No valid radiation output requests have been generated. This may be because exist in the model.
سلام
نکته ای که شما اشاره کردید هشداره، خطا نیست و موجب قطع تحلیل نمیشه
خطا هم مربوط به عدم ثبت نتایج خروجی بوده (خروجی مربوط به تحلیل انتقال حرارت تابشی که اصلا در این مسئله مطرح نیست)
برای پیدا کردن دلیل قطع تحلیل باید Errorها را بررسی کنید
با سلام مجدد و تشکر از راهنمایی شما. کاملا صحیح می فرمایید یک Errors به این متن ظاهر شده و ظاهرا مدل نتونسته وارد مرحله آنالیز بشه. متن Error به شکل زیر میباشد. لطفا در این مورد راهنمایی فرمایید. با سپاس
specific heat requires the use of*density*
Analysis Input File Processor exited with an error.
چگالی ماده مورد نظر را وارد نکردهاید
چگالی: 7.8g/cm^3
بی نهایت سپاسگذارم. شما واقعا با این سایت و وقتی که میذارین نعمتین آقای مهندس.
سپاسگزارم
برقرار باشید
سلام جناب مهندس. من این مدل رو خیلی روش کار کردم اما کانتوری که بعد از تحلیل بدست میارم این المانها ی مسیر جوش وقتی خط جوش داره جلو میاد همش قرمز هستن و المانهای اطراف خط جوش هم زرد و سبز و نهایتا آبی میشن. سرعت حرکت خط جوش هم خیلی بیشتر از نتایج مثال شماست. انگار انتشار حرارت هم فقط در عرض المان خط جوش و یک المان در سمت چپ و راست آن اتفاق میفتد. لطفا راهنمایی بفرمایید. با تشکر
به نظر شما بدون دیدن مدل چطوری کمک کنم؟!
دقت داشته باشید کانتور نشان داده شده کانتور دماست، در خصوص سرعت هم شما میتونید در Visualization هر مقدار خواستید انیمیشن را آهسته یا تند کنید
با سلام خدمت شما.من یه سوالی داشتم و اون هم اینست که من یک مدل طراحی و انالیز کردم و لی متاسفانه دمایی که برای جوش نشان میدهد در قسمت کانتورها یک عدد مثبت با توان منفی است.در قسمت اموزش, شما عدد وارده در قسمت load را برابر 200 در نظر گرفته اید.سوالی که دارم اینست که این عدد راچگونه بدست اورده اید؟ و من چه طور می توانم عدد مربوط به تحلیل جوشکاری ام را یک عدد مطابق با حرارت جوشکاری و بدون توان منفی بدست بیاورم.
با تشکرر از ساایت و بسیاااار خوب و مفیدتون
خدا خیرتون بده
سلام
صرفا یک دمای ورودی هست؛ هر مقداری که فکر میکنید به واقعیت نزدیکتره وارد کنید
در جریان جزئیات تحلیل شما نیستم که بتونم روی خروجی ها و نتایج نظر داشته باشم
موفق باشید . . .
با سلام خدمت آقای سروری
من میخوام یک جوش لب به لب v شکل(single v butt welding) رو در نرم افزار آباکوس مدل کنم و تست خستگی خمشی را روی آن انجام دهم. به دنبال یک استاندارد میگشتم واسه این کار که از اندازه های استاندارد واسه مدل کردن این نمونه استفاده کنم ولی متاسفانه این استاندارد رو پیدا نکردم و حتی در مقاله های مرتبط نیز سرچ کردم.فقط یک استاندارد به نام ASTM STP 648 پیدا کردم و نمیدونم که واسه کار من هست یا نه.
خواستم اگر امکانش هست در این زمینه بهم کمک کنید.
با تشکر
سلام
در خصوص بحث خستگی یک رفرنس جامع وجود داره که ممکنه بتونه کمکتون کنه (Handbook of Fatigue Testing, STP 566)
رفرنسی هم که خودتون اشاره کردید از مراجع متداول به شمار میره
استاندارد ISO/TR 14345:2012 هم به بحث خستگی در اتصالات جوشکاری شده میپردازه
همچنین استاندارد TWI مباحثی در خصوص خستگی داره؛ پیشنهاد میکنم مطالعه کنید (استاندارد TWI در خستگی سازه های جوشکاری شده-لینک جستجو)
موفق باشید . . .
سلام
میخواستم بدونم از نرم افزار deform 3D امکان انتقال داده های حرارتی خروجی از این نرم افزار به آباکوس وجود داره؟
چون در ادامه قرار هست با این داده ها شبیه سازی جوش در آباکوس انجام بشه.
سلام
اطلاعی ندارم
با سلام
امکانش هست تحلیل تنش اتصال 2 لوله ساده جدار نازک که توسط عملیات جوشکاری با یکدیگر متصل می شوند را توضیح بدهید؟ باتشکر
سلام
پس از مدلسازی لوله ها از قید Tie برای اتصال دو قطعه استفاده کنید (آشنایی با قید Tie در آباکوس)
موفق باشید . . .
ممنون. و اگر بخواهم محل جوش را به صورت تخصصی بررسی کنم به چه صورت می باشد؟
به مثال زیر رجوع کنید؛ میتونه راهگشا باشه
تحلیل جوشT شکل در آباکوس
سلام
در تحلیل انتقال حرارت جوشکاری از قید tie بین دو قطعه استفاده کردم و از استپ coupled temp. disp استفاده کردم(چون نیاز به مقادیر تنش هم دارم)
ولی یکی اینکه دو قطعه با هم دمایشان تغییر میکند و در همه جایشان(نه فقط در المانهای خط جوش) و دوم اینکه در خروجیهام تنش وجود نداره با اینکه قطعات را مقید نموده ام.
لطفا راهنمایی کنید.
سلام
نظری ندارم چون من از شرایط مرزی، بارگذاری، صورت مسئله و از همه مهمتر مدلسازی که شما انجام داده اید اطلاعی ندارم
موفق باشید . . .
در مسئله ای که حل کردید time period را چند گرفتید برای هر استپ؟
من این مسئله را همانند آنچه گفته اید انجام دادم ولی تغییرات دمایی setها با هم اتفاق می افتد و خط اثر جوش پیدا نیست
1 واحد زمانی
اگر مسئله را دقیقا مطابق گامها انجام بدهید مشکلی پیش نمیاد
ببخشید نباید همانند تعریف load ، خروجیها هم در استپهای جداگانه تعریف شوند و در هر هرکدام استپهای دیگر غیر فعال شود؟
ببخشید الان خوب شد ولی باز مشکلی که هست اینکه خط اثر جوش مثل اونی نیست که شما گذاشتید. قرمز شدن setها به صورت یک خط ممتد پیش میرود. یعنی با قرمز شدن هریک قبلی هم قرمز باقی میماند.
کاش میشد عکسش رو براتون بفرستم مهندس
کانتوری که من گذاشتم دمایی است، به این نکته توجه داشته باشید
اگر مطابق مراحل بالا پیش رفته باشید کانتور شما هم به همین شکل خواهد شد
با حوصله و تمرکز کار را انجام بدهید
خیر
عذر میخوام در صورت وارد کردن ضریب انبساط حرارتی با بکارگیری استپ couple temp. disp و مقید کردن قطعه از طرفین شاهد اعوجاج و تغییر شکلهای بزرگ هستیم و مقادیر تنش هم نمایان میشوند که با آن میتوان تنشهای پسماند را اندازه گیری کرد.
در بحث جوشکاری این قضیه به واقعیت نزدیکتر نیست؟
بستگی به زاویه دید شما و هدفتون از تحلیل داره
در اینجا بحث بیشتر انتقال حرارت بوده نه آنالیز تنش
سلام و خدا قوت
یه ماده ای میخوام تعریف کنم که خواص ماده طی دماهای مختلف تغییر پیدا میکنه مثل ضریب رسانش چگالی و …
چطور باید این کارو انجام ردم
سلام
در هر بخش که قصد وارد کردن داده را دارید (چگالی، ضریب رسانش، خواص مکانیکی و . . .) یک گزینه تحت عنوان use temperature-dependent data وجود داره
با فعال کردن تیک مربوطه میتونید خواص مورد نظر را در دمای دلخواه وارد کنید
سلام و خسته نباشید
در مورد افزونه weld modeler میشه یه مرجع یا فایلی معرفی کنید که روش کار با اونو آموزش بده؟
من نمیدونم چطوری میشه باهاش کار کرد و بهش نیاز دارم
سلام
مرجع خاصی براش وجود نداره؛ اما فیلمهایی از حل مثال با افزونه weld modeler در آباکوس وجود داره که میتونه مفید باشه
سرچ کنید راحت پیدا میشه
میشه بگید چ امکاناتی داره این ماژول؟ مثلا قابلیت تعریف ولتاژ ورودی، ماده پر کننده، اندازه گیری تنش پسماند و …
در حقیقت میشه بجای سابروتین نویسی از این استفاده کرد؟
میتونید توضیحات مربوط به افزونه weld modeler را در کاتالوگ زیر مطالعه کنید:
معرفی پلاگین weld modeler در آباکوس
معرفی Extension های آباکوس
اون لینک دانلودی ک بالاتر از افزونه گذاشتید جوش دوبعدی و سه بعدی هست؟
تنها نسخه موجود از weld modeler همینه
فیلم حل مسئله جوش سه بعدی با پلاگین weld modeler در آباکوس
فیلم حل مسئله جوش دو بعدی با پلاگین weld modeler در آباکوس
? ممنون میشم همه پرسشهاتون را در قالب یک کامنت طرح کنید تا نظم سایت بهم نخوره
با سلام و تبریک سال نو
بدست آوردن تمرکز تنش محل اتصال دو قطعه استوانه شکل که توسط عملیات جوشکاری شده به هم متصل شده اند در نرم افزار آباکوس به چه صورت می باشد؟ ((قطعات تحت فشار داخلی می باشند)) با تشکر
سلام
نوروز شما هم مبارک
میتونید این مقاله را مطالعه بفرمایید : محاسبه ضریب تمرکز تنش در اتصالات جوشی به کمک آباکوس
موفق باشید . . .
سلام
آیا روش دیگری برای تحلیل حرارت در مسیر های طولانی با تعداد المان زیاد وجود دارد؟ (این روش با افزایش المان بسیار زمان گیر خواهد بود)
از توجه و صبر شما متشکرم
سلام
میتونید از یک اسکریپت پایتون یا سابروتین DFLUX استفاده کنید
موفق باشید
امکانش هست منبعی (فارسی یا انگلیسی) برای یادگیری سابروتین و اسکریپت نویسی در آباکوس معرفی بفرمایید؟
خیلی ممنون
برای سابروتین میتونید فایل زیر را دانلود کنید:
https://goo.gl/rKs2Xo
برای اسکریپت باید مبانی زبان پایتون را یاد بگیرید؛ سرچ کنید منبع زیاده
بینهایت متشکرم
سلام و عرض ادب
وقت شما به خیر وشادی
سرعت چرخش ابزار در جوشکاری اصطکاکی اغتشاشی در نرم افزار چگونه باید اعمال شود؟
سپاس
سلام
در ماژول Load بخش شرایط مرزی (BC)، زیر مجموعه Mechanical گزینه ای تحت عنوان Velocity/Angular Velocity وجود داره که میتونید بوسیله این گزینه سرعت دورانی مورد نظرتون را به قطعه اعمال کنید
موفق باشید . . .
سلام
سپاسگزارم
شاد و پیروز باشید
برقرار باشید